The difference between spider silk, hairy silk and red silk

The difference between spider silk, hairy silk and red silk

The difference between spider silk and hairy silk

The characteristic of spider silk is that there are a large number of spider web-like hairs wrapped around the tip of the leaves, and the diameter and density of the hairs of each plant are different. The leaves are flat, mostly light green, with pointed tips, and the petals are pink with dark stripes mixed in them.

The difference between the hairy curled silk and the spider silk curled silk is that the leaves of the hairy curled silk are covered with small hairs, while the leaves of the spider silk curled silk are smooth, with only the inter-leaf parts having sticky natural hairs.

The difference between spider silk and red silk

Red Curly Hair is a perennial succulent herb with leaves that grow radially. Fine, short white hairs grow on the leaf tips. The center of the plant is particularly dense, like a spider web, and is very similar to spider silk.

The difference between spider silk curled silk and red curled silk is that the leaves of red curled silk are mostly medium green or red, especially in cool and sunny places, the leaves will be purple-red. The leaves of spider silk are generally green.
